The HD-EO can support a number of different broadcast formats. The correct configuration can either be set with a DIP switch or with the GYDA Control System. The layout of HD-EO is shown in the drawing below with the DIP switch to the upper left position.
Figure 3 - Overview of the SDI-C1 connector module In typical use a HD-EO / HD-OE module at each end will be used. The electrical input signal is connected to the DIGITAL INPUT BNC on the transmitting HD-EO, and the electrical output is connected to the DIGITAL OUTPUT 1 or DIGITAL OUTPUT 2 BNC on the receiving HD-OE.
